2. A Diverse Range of Designs

These exquisite carpets are available in a broad assortment of patterns, from the minimalist and earth-toned shades of Beni Ourain rugs to the colorful, intricate motifs of Boujad rugs. Whether your taste leans toward a refined look or bold colors, there is a Moroccan rug to complement your decor.

• Classic Berber Weavings – These feature plush, muted shades and geometric patterns, ideal in modern interiors.

• Lively Tribal Carpets – Known for vivid tones and abstract patterns, these rugs add a lively accent to various settings.

• Azilal Rugs – A mix of classic geometric elegance and bold hues, creating a one-of-a-kind combination of styles.

• Flatwoven Tapestries – Non-pile weavings featuring sharp angular designs, commonly displayed as decorative wall hangings or floor coverings.

This variety ensures that no matter your design preference, you can find a Moroccan rug that elevates your space.

6. Strength and Longevity

These artisanal textiles exemplify resilience. Due to the premium-grade fleece and meticulous weaving techniques, they can withstand frequent movement and regular handling while maintaining their beauty throughout the years.

With proper care, a handwoven carpet may remain pristine for decades, even generations. Regular vacuuming, occasional shaking, and gentle spot cleaning help retain their vibrant and rich colors. Acquiring these exquisite pieces secures a decorative element with lasting significance.

7. A Historical Link

Owning a Moroccan rug feels akin to preserving cultural heritage. Every handcrafted piece conveys a narrative, reflecting the ancestral customs and ways of life of the Berber tribes who create them. Beyond being an aesthetic addition; it’s a connection with deep-rooted traditions.

The symbols and motifs imbued within each textile possess symbolic depth, denoting here fertility, protection, and spirituality. Such meaningful artistry infuses greater value to their visual charm, making them treasured pieces into timeless artifacts.
